Abstract
We present the design, construction, and test results of a novel microwiggler structure with a periodicity of 2.4 mm for free-electron laser applications. The experimentally demonstrated tunability of field amplitude provides versatile means for field tapering, optical klystron configurations, improving field uniformity, and electron beam matching at the wiggler entrance.Keywords
